Jimmy Kimmel Mocks Trump over Lincoln Memorial Pool Turning Green
Kimmel said the $14 million project left the pool green within a week, as National Park Service crews used hydrogen peroxide to clean algae.
- On Tuesday, Jimmy Kimmel mocked President Donald Trump for a $14 million Lincoln Memorial Reflecting Pool renovation that turned green with algae just one week after completion.
- Trump ordered the Reflecting Pool on the National Mall resurfaced and repainted "American flag blue" because he disliked its original appearance.
- Experts explain that the dark paint retains heat, fostering algae growth, while the White House in Washington describes the discoloration as "residual algae."
- National Park Service workers are cleaning the pool with hydrogen peroxide, a development Kimmel used to joke about Trump's promise to "drain the swamp."
- Kimmel concluded by sarcastically suggesting Trump might move Patrick Day to July to justify the green water, calling it one of his "dumb and crazy" problems.
